常用方法和属性(Common methods and attributes)获取get(x)x是元素的ID || dom元素对象 || ExtElement对象将参数所指转化为ExtElement对象并返回它(非Dom元素对象,而是对Dom元素的封装),此方法等同于new Ext.Element(x) 。Ext.select(x) x是选择器返回一个CompositeElement对象,表示ExtElment对象的集合。但返回的这个对象实际上并非数组,不能通过数组索引访问它包含的数据。但可以通过each方法对集合里的每个对象进行迭代...
Ext.onReady(function(){
/**
extjs 容器组件的layout属性可以设置它的显示风格,以下视情况选用:
- Auto - **默认**
- hbox //水平方向排列
- vbox //垂直方向排列1)absolute:在容器内部,根据指定的坐标定位显示。
2)accordion:手风琴效果。
3)anchor: 注意以下几点:1.容器内的组件要么指定宽度,要么在anchor中同时指定高/宽2.anchor值通常只能为负值(指非百分比值),正值没有意义。3.anchor必须为字符串值
4) border :将...
uses -- 被引用的类可以在该类之后才加载.requires -- 被引用的类必须在该类之前加载.alias : 相当于别名一样,可以起多个,可以通过xtype创建实例,我现在接触的有三种类型,根据不懂的类型用不同的前缀 1. widget 使用(widget.test 组件) 2. viewmodel (viewmodel.test) 3. controller (controller.test) 原文:http://www.cnblogs.com/shaoshao/p/4119157.html
如何更改树节点的属性?
一个树节点具有以下属性:{"id":"75",
"description":"My Tree Node",
"status":"25"
"uiProvider":"col",
"leaf":true}现在我的脚本收到以下数据{
"id":"75",
"status":"100",
"cls":"done"
}我尝试更新属性(UPDATED):// a.result.data has the new data and taskID is the node's id
for (var property in a.result.data)
{ tree.getNodeById(taskID).attributes[property] = a.result.data[property];
...
1.界面修改(css style): Extjs中界面风格与我们产品本身的风格有很大不同,从边框、选中行的颜色到鼠标移动到的行的颜色、菜单等,几乎都不同。Extjs对这些样式的设置都是由css完成的。如: 选中行的颜色就可用如下设置完成: .x-grid3-row-selected{background:#c6e2ff!important;} 其他的都类似,只要找到对应的class, 然后设置要修改的部分即可。 2. 属性的作用(About Ext.grid. GroupingView, EditorGridPanel): Extjs的grid功...
Ext修改GridPanel数据和字体颜色等,不是单指EditGridPanel 首先获取选中的行(当然也可以获取单元格): 代码如下: var selectedRow = grid.getSelectionModel().getSelected(); 修改设置: 代码如下: selectedRow.set("key","value"); 修改背景色,首先获取行号,然后获取行的view对象: 代码如下: var selectedIdx = grid.store.indexOf(selectedRow); var selectedView = grid.getView().getRow(selectedIdx); 修改行的c...
设置:style:"position:relative;top:2px 代码如下: var factorName = new Ext.form.Label({ id : factorName, fieldLabel : 要素名称, style:"position:relative;top:2px;", text : simpleGrid.getItems(factorName), anchor : 100% });
设置:style:"position:relative;top:2px 代码如下:var factorName = new Ext.form.Label({ id : factorName, fieldLabel : 要素名称, style:"position:relative;top:2px;", text : simpleGrid.getItems(factorName), anchor : 100% });
1.界面修改(css style): Extjs中界面风格与我们产品本身的风格有很大不同,从边框、选中行的颜色到鼠标移动到的行的颜色、菜单等,几乎都不同。Extjs对这些样式的设置都是由css完成的。如: 选中行的颜色就可用如下设置完成: .x-grid3-row-selected{background:#c6e2ff!important;} 其他的都类似,只要找到对应的class, 然后设置要修改的部分即可。 2. 属性的作用(About Ext.grid. GroupingView, EditorGridPanel): Extjs的grid功...